ConnectSecure announced the launch of its new Google Workspace
Assessments. This powerful new capability enhances ConnectSecure's
vulnerability platform by empowering MSPs to assess, detect, and mitigate risks
within their clients' Google Workspace environments. With this addition,
ConnectSecure expands its cloud assessment capabilities beyond Microsoft 365,
offering broader protection across key collaboration platforms.
As cloud
adoption accelerates, the need for visibility and control over third-party
platforms has never been greater. With the new Google Workspace Assessments,
MSPs can now identify vulnerabilities, flag configuration issues, and generate
client-facing reports -- all within minutes. This offering is designed to
proactively reduce risk across a suite of cloud applications, including Gmail,
Google Drive, Google Meet and Calendar.

This new
offering complements ConnectSecure's broader mission: to deliver a single,
unified platform for risk assessments across networks, endpoints,
vulnerabilities, Microsoft 365 and now Google Workspace.
